您的位置:首页 >如何用grep快速查找nohup日志信息
发布于2026-05-03 阅读(0)
扫一扫,手机访问
打开终端,咱们就开始一步步操作。
首先,用cd命令切换到存放nohup日志的文件夹。命令很简单:
cd /path/to/your/log/directory
把路径换成你实际存放nohup.out文件的位置就行。
接下来,使用grep命令去匹配你关心的关键词或正则表达式。比如,想找出所有包含“error”的记录,可以运行:
grep -i "error" nohup.out
这里有个小技巧:-i参数能让搜索忽略大小写,这样无论是“Error”、“ERROR”还是“error”都逃不过你的眼睛。"error"是你要找的核心词,而nohup.out则是默认的日志文件名。
如果需要盯着日志,看有没有新的错误信息冒出来,可以把tail和grep组合起来用:
tail -c +1 nohup.out | grep -i "error"
这行命令里,-c +1让tail从文件开头读取,然后通过管道|把内容实时送给grep过滤。这样,屏幕上就会持续输出匹配“error”的新增行。
有时候日志量很大,你只想快速瞥一眼最近的几条相关记录。这时,在grep后面接上head命令就非常方便:
grep -i "error" nohup.out | head -n 10
这个命令组合能帮你筛选出包含“error”的前10行内容,一目了然。
总的来说,上面这几条命令构成了查找nohup日志最核心的操作。你可以灵活变通,替换不同的搜索关键词、调整正则表达式,或者改变行数限制,来满足各种具体的排查需求。
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
正版软件
正版软件
正版软件
正版软件
正版软件
1
2
3
7
9